Comparing breathing exercises for stronger diaphragm in healthy adults

Diaphragm ThicknessDyspnoea

Part of Lungs & breathing clinical trials.

This study compares three training methods to improve the strength and endurance of the diaphragm, the main muscle used for breathing. It aims to find the most effective way to improve breathing in young healthy people.

Who can take part

  • Be between 18 and 45 years old (implied by 'young healthy adults', but not specified; if age is not specified, please confirm with the study team).
  • Have a body mass index (BMI) between 18.5 and 29.9.
  • Be a non-smoker.
  • Have not done specific breathing muscle training in the past 6 months.
  • Be able to give informed consent and follow study procedures.
